How Does It Work?
Participating is wonderfully straightforward. You can grab a physical passport booklet or opt for the convenience of a digital app. The core idea is simple: visit the participating locations, get your stamp (either in your booklet or digitally), and collect those coveted 'likes' from the state itself. There's no purchase necessary to get a stamp, making it accessible for everyone. The program runs from May 1st to September 30th each year, with booklet prize entries needing to be postmarked by early October.
Prizes and Participation
And yes, there are prizes! By collecting stamps, you earn entries for prizes. Each individual can submit their own prize entry form or have their own digital app account. So, if you're traveling with family, each member can participate independently and potentially win. It’s a great incentive to make a real adventure out of it.
